1322 Masonic is one of six exquisite Victorians built by Robert Cranston circa 1890 in a picture-perfect row of upper Haight Ashbury. Architectural details and period moldings abound as you make your way through the home. Decorative trim, centerpieces, lincrusta, and hand-painted stained glass windows are just a few of the features. On the main level are the formal living and dining rooms, a casual family room adjacent to the renovated kitchen, and a powder room. The designer kitchen includes top-of-the-line SubZero, Bosch, Thermador, and Viking appliances. Natural light floods the kitchen which features custom cherry cabinetry, granite countertops, bar seating and a breakfast nook overlooking the rear yard, which is accessible through French doors. An impressively manicured yard creates a park-like setting. Upstairs are four bedrooms and two full baths, including a private master suite. The master features cathedral ceilings and large picture windows that overlook the terraces gracing the back yard. Neighborhood Description 1322 Masonic is located in prestigious Ashbury Heights, and is proximate to Cole Valley, Buena Vista Park, Golden Gate Park, and NOPA.
